对象数组_对象数组根据元素属性删除!

beiqi IT运维 3

本文目录一览:

什么是对象数组

1、对象数组就是数组里的每个对象都是类的对象,赋值时先定义对象,然后将对象直接赋给数组就行了。

对象数组_对象数组根据元素属性删除!-第1张图片-增云技术工坊
(图片来源网络,侵删)

2、对象数组的本质是数组,数组里面存储的数据类型是某个类的对象。而数组对象的本质是对象,也就是一个数组对象,也就是一个数组,这个数组里面存储的数据类型可以使各种各样的数据类型。

3、对象数组就是数组里的每个元素都是类的对象,赋值时先定义对象,然后将对象直接赋给数组。关于对象数组,以下是由我整理关于对象数组的内容,希望大家喜欢!对象数组的介绍 (1)类 具有相同或相似性质的对象的抽象就是类。因此,对象的抽象是类,类的具体化就是对象,也可以说类的实例是对象。

对象数组_对象数组根据元素属性删除!-第2张图片-增云技术工坊
(图片来源网络,侵删)

4、对象:基于类(Class)定义,封装数据(属性)和行为(方法)。需先声明类结构,再通过new关键字实例化。每个对象是独立实体,属性值可不同。数组:无需类定义,直接通过array()或[]创建。是键值对集合,键可为数字(索引数组)或字符串(关联数组),值可以是任意数据类型。

什么是对象数组有哪些特征与要素

对象数组就是数组里的每个元素都是类的对象,赋值时先定义对象,然后将对象直接赋给数组。关于对象数组,以下是由我整理关于对象数组的内容,希望大家喜欢!对象数组的介绍 (1)类 具有相同或相似性质的对象的抽象就是类。因此,对象的抽象是类,类的具体化就是对象,也可以说类的实例是对象。类具有属性,它是对象的状态的抽象,用数据结构来描述类的属性。

对象数组_对象数组根据元素属性删除!-第3张图片-增云技术工坊
(图片来源网络,侵删)

对象:因包含额外元数据(类信息、方法表等),内存占用通常高于数组。数组:内存效率更高,尤其在处理大量简单数据时。 使用场景 优先用对象:需结构化数据、复用逻辑或实现抽象设计时(如MVC模型)。优先用数组:快速存储/访问简单数据,或与外部系统(如JSON API)交互时(数组更易序列化)。

对象数组就是数组里的每个对象都是类的对象,赋值时先定义对象,然后将对象直接赋给数组就行了。

java怎么定义一个对象数组

1、在 Java 中,定义数组对象需通过声明变量、创建对象并初始化大小、访问元素三个步骤完成,具体如下: 声明数组变量使用数据类型[] 变量名语法声明一个数组变量,用于后续引用数组对象。

2、基本语法使用以下语法创建对象数组:ClassName[] arrayName = new ClassName[size];ClassName:要存储的对象类型(可以是内置类或自定义类)。arrayName:数组变量名。size:数组长度(创建后不可变)。

3、方法 1:使用 new 运算符通过 new 运算符创建指定类型和大小的对象数组,数组元素初始值为 null(需后续手动赋值)。语法ClassName[] arrayName = new ClassName[size];ClassName:对象数组的元素类型(如 String、自定义类等)。arrayName:数组变量名。size:数组长度(固定大小)。

详谈js中数组和对象的区别

我后来才知道对象数组,数组表示有序数据的集合对象数组,而对象表示无序数据的集合。如果数据的顺序很重要对象数组,就用数组,否则就用对象。当然,数组和对象的另一个区别是,数组的数据没有”名称”(name),对象的数据有”名称”(name)。但是问题是,很多编程语言中,都有一种叫做”关联数组”(associative array)的东西。这种数组中的数据是有名称的。

首先,“对象数组”,在我的理解里可以理解成两种可能对象数组:其一,数组中的元素全部是对象,即由对象构成的数组;其二,JS中以键值对组合成的对象,由于可以使用类似数组取值的方式读取对象属性的值,因此对象也可看作一种特殊的数组。

在 JavaScript 中,判断变量是数组还是对象可以通过以下方法实现:判断数组使用 Array.isArray()这是最可靠的方法,直接返回布尔值:const arr = [1, 2, 3];console.log(Array.isArray(arr); // true判断对象使用 typeof返回变量的类型字符串。

判断两个数组对象是否相同,是前端开发中常见的需求。在JavaScript中,多种方法可以实现这一目标,但各有适用场景。首先,typeof只能用于判断基本类型和对象,但它无法区分数组和对象。其次,instanceof特性虽然能判断对象是否为某种特定类型,但它在判断数组和对象时皆返回true,因此无法区分两者。

标签: 对象数组

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~